I've installed and tested 3 different backup cameras on my car, and the one that I found was the best was Wendy's cam.

This is what it looks like..
http://cgi.ebay.com/ebaymotors/ws/eB...m=150206974666

The reason I chose this one is because it provides a wide angle, and is the most visible at night. I can see clearly at night with just my stock reverse lights on (even on a pitch dark street). Similiar to the factory cameras you see on other cars.
